Understanding Pressing Mechanics in EA FC 26
Before learning advanced pressing, you need to understand the three core mechanics that control defensive pressure in the game.
Team Press
Team Press activates a coordinated press across your entire squad. Once triggered, your players will push forward aggressively and try to win the ball high up the pitch. This tactic is ideal when you want to apply constant pressure or chase a goal late in the match.
However, Team Press drains stamina quickly and only lasts for a short duration, so timing is critical.
Second Man Press
Second Man Press is one of the most commonly used defensive tools in the current meta. By holding the designated button, you command the nearest AI-controlled teammate to pressure the ball carrier while you control another player.
This allows you to cut off passing lanes manually while the AI applies pressure, creating a two-player pressing situation.
Partial Team Press
Partial Team Press is a more controlled version of pressing. Instead of aggressively chasing the ball, nearby players focus on blocking passing options and covering runs.
This is particularly effective when defending near your box or when you want to force your opponent into predictable passes.
How to Press With Multiple Players Effectively
To truly dominate defensively, you need to combine manual defending with AI-assisted pressure.
Combining Manual and AI Press
The most effective way to press with multiple players is to control one defender manually while activating Second Man Press. This creates immediate pressure on the ball carrier while allowing you to anticipate and intercept passes.
Once the opponent moves the ball, quickly switch to another defender and continue the press. This constant switching creates a suffocating effect that limits your opponent’s options.
Using Partial Team Press to Block Passing Lanes
When your opponent approaches your defensive third, switch to Partial Team Press. This will position your players to cut off key passing lanes and prevent through balls.
At this stage, patience is more important than aggression. Wait for a mistake rather than overcommitting.
High Press Strategy in the Final Third
If you want to win the ball near your opponent’s goal, combine Team Press with a high defensive line. This compresses the space and forces your opponent into rushed decisions.
Adding an Offside Trap to this setup pushes your defensive line forward and keeps your team compact, making it easier to intercept passes and regain possession quickly.
Best Situations to Use Multi-Player Pressing
Pressing is powerful, but using it at the wrong time can leave your defense exposed.
When to Press
After losing possession in midfield
When your opponent is under pressure near their box
During late-game scenarios when you need a goal
When to Avoid Pressing
Against players who use quick one-two passes
When your defenders are low on stamina
When protecting a lead late in the game
Balancing aggression and control is key to maintaining defensive stability.
Squad Requirements for Effective Pressing
Not every squad can handle high-intensity pressing. You need players with specific attributes to execute this tactic effectively.
Key Attributes
High stamina to sustain constant pressure
Good pace to close down opponents quickly
Strong defensive awareness for interceptions
Agility and balance for quick direction changes
Midfielders and fullbacks are especially important in pressing systems, as they cover the most ground during matches.

Advanced Tips to Master Pressing
To truly excel, you need to refine your timing and decision-making.
Use short bursts of pressure instead of constant pressing
Switch players quickly to maintain defensive shape
Avoid dragging defenders out of position unnecessarily
Track stamina and rotate players when needed
These small adjustments can make a huge difference in high-level matches.
